One-liner
A highly configurable Apple Watch-only workout app with advanced map navigation, real-time alerts, and deep data customization for outdoor activities like running, cycling, and hiking.
Strengths
Extensive customization of workout screens with over 800 data fields available
Smooth vector map display during workouts with turn-by-turn route navigation
Works independently of iPhone, ideal for long outdoor sessions
Seamless integration with Apple Health for automatic workout syncing
Highly detailed alert system (e.g., pace drops, heart rate spikes, off-route)
Weaknesses
Overwhelming UI/UX — users describe it as confusing, unintuitive, and poorly designed ("accidentally dropped on its head" review)
Lack of documentation or in-app guidance for settings ("no explanation what a setting does")
Steep learning curve despite powerful features — many users fail to configure it properly after weeks of use
Frequent complaints about inconsistent behavior and bugs in core workflows
Price point (€9.99) feels unjustified given usability issues and lack of support
